This print showcases a remarkable artwork titled "Group of four singers" by the renowned Italian artist Jacopo Pontormo. The image captures a moment frozen in time, as four singers stand together, engrossed in their music book. Their voices harmoniously fill the air as they passionately sing from the pages before them. Pontormo's masterful use of sanguine drawing technique brings depth and emotion to this piece. Each stroke of his hand reveals intricate details that highlight the individuality and expressions of these talented performers. It is evident that Pontormo was not only a skilled painter but also an astute observer of human nature. Part of the Florentine School, Pontormo's work reflects the artistic brilliance that flourished during this period. This particular piece stands out for its intimate portrayal of musicians engaged in their craft, capturing both their concentration and camaraderie. The print offers viewers a glimpse into history, allowing us to appreciate Handzeichnungen alter Meister aus der Albertina und anderen Sammlungen (Hand drawings by old masters from the Albertina and other collections). Published by Joseph Schönbrunner and Dr. Joseph Meder in Vienna under Gerlach & Schenk Verlag für Kunst und Kunstgewerbe, it serves as a testament to timeless artistry.
